By examining two different isotopes one can determine specific features about the molecule and its absorption spectrum.( Spectroscopy is a very useful tool for investigating the properties (e.g. structures) of molecules.)
Calculate the vibrational level energies in units of the Planck constant h for H35Cl and H37Cl where ˜ν35 = 2885.64 cm-1 and ˜ν37 = 2883.456 cm-1, What is the probability of populating the first excited vibrational state (n = 1) at 298 K? Does isotopic substitution affect the probability? Would the intensity of absorption peaks be affected by isotopic substitution? If yes, which isotope has a greater intensity?
